For the first time, members of an American Episcopal Church have chosen a man as bishop who frankly declared that he is a homosexual.

A new film by Mel Gibson called “Passion” is expected to cause a conflict between Christians and Jews in the US. The film is said to be anti-Semitic and not theologically accurate. The author believes that such an expected conflict shows that relations between Jews and Christians are weak.
